Gentoo Archives: gentoo-commits

From: "Stefaan De Roeck (stefaan)" <stefaan@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] gentoo-x86 commit in net-fs/openafs/files: openafs-ppc64.patch
Date: Wed, 19 Sep 2007 14:33:10
Message-Id: E1IXwzF-00017o-3l@stork.gentoo.org
1 stefaan 07/09/19 10:40:53
2
3 Added: openafs-ppc64.patch
4 Log:
5 Fix for ppc64 (bug #191216)
6 (Portage version: 2.1.3.9)
7
8 Revision Changes Path
9 1.1 net-fs/openafs/files/openafs-ppc64.patch
10
11 file : http://sources.gentoo.org/viewcvs.py/gentoo-x86/net-fs/openafs/files/openafs-ppc64.patch?rev=1.1&view=markup
12 plain: http://sources.gentoo.org/viewcvs.py/gentoo-x86/net-fs/openafs/files/openafs-ppc64.patch?rev=1.1&content-type=text/plain
13
14 Index: openafs-ppc64.patch
15 ===================================================================
16 --- src/afs/afs_call.c.old 2007-09-09 14:38:44.000000000 +0400
17 +++ src/afs/afs_call.c 2007-09-09 14:50:18.460222354 +0400
18 @@ -1340,7 +1340,11 @@ copyin_iparam(caddr_t cmarg, struct ipar
19 if (current->thread.flags & THREAD_IA32)
20
21 #elif defined(AFS_PPC64_LINUX26_ENV)
22 - if (current->thread_info->flags & _TIF_32BIT)
23 +#if defined(STRUCT_TASK_STRUCT_HAS_THREAD_INFO)
24 + if (current->thread_info->flags & _TIF_32BIT)
25 +#else
26 + if (current_thread_info()->flags & _TIF_32BIT)
27 +#endif
28 #elif defined(AFS_PPC64_LINUX20_ENV)
29 if (current->thread.flags & PPC_FLAG_32BIT)
30
31 --- src/afs/afs_pioctl.c.bak 2007-09-18 01:12:03.000000000 -0400
32 +++ src/afs/afs_pioctl.c 2007-09-18 01:12:40.000000000 -0400
33 @@ -284,7 +284,11 @@
34 if (current->thread.flags & THREAD_IA32)
35
36 #elif defined(AFS_PPC64_LINUX26_ENV)
37 +#if defined(STRUCT_TASK_STRUCT_HAS_THREAD_INFO)
38 if (current->thread_info->flags & _TIF_32BIT)
39 +#else
40 + if (current_thread_info()->flags & _TIF_32BIT)
41 +#endif
42 #elif defined(AFS_PPC64_LINUX20_ENV)
43 if (current->thread.flags & PPC_FLAG_32BIT)
44
45
46
47
48 --
49 gentoo-commits@g.o mailing list